Transaction 78896610511ec2043118b8dbae6e7fd9df6b496d93633dd6454f674227715727
1 Input
1 Output
-
78896610511ec2043118b8dbae6e7fd9df6b496d93633dd6454f674227715727:0
- value
- 67000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a18fd3c7346f0774d4ac2ef389622fa7f3d8ec8 OP_EQUAL
- address
- 35XcEt3jcfN31VnvWfhgW3ia6MVgiqfaua